|
@@ -1,17 +1,29 @@
|
|
|
+<wxs src="../../utils/filter.wxs" module="filters" />
|
|
|
+
|
|
|
<view class="chat">
|
|
|
<scroll-view scroll-y="true" class="content" scroll-top="{{scrollTop}}" enhanced show-scrollbar='{{false}}'
|
|
|
refresher-enabled bindrefresherrefresh='getMsgDet' refresher-triggered="{{triggered}}">
|
|
|
<block wx:for="{{list}}" wx:key="id">
|
|
|
<view class="base someone" wx:if="{{uid!=item.senderUid}}">
|
|
|
<image src="{{item.user.avatar}}" class="avatar" bindtap="jumpUserInfo" data-uid='{{item.senderUid}}' />
|
|
|
- <view class="message" wx:if="{{item.type==1}}">{{item.content}}</view>
|
|
|
- <image src="{{item.content}}" wx:else class="msgImg" mode="widthFix" bindtap="previewImage"
|
|
|
- data-src="{{item.content}}" />
|
|
|
+ <view class="contentBox">
|
|
|
+ <view class="time">
|
|
|
+ {{filters.formatDate(item.gmtCreated,1)}}
|
|
|
+ </view>
|
|
|
+ <view class="message" wx:if="{{item.type==1}}">{{item.content}}</view>
|
|
|
+ <image src="{{item.content}}" wx:else class="msgImg" mode="widthFix" bindtap="previewImage"
|
|
|
+ data-src="{{item.content}}" />
|
|
|
+ </view>
|
|
|
</view>
|
|
|
<view class="base self" wx:else>
|
|
|
- <view class="message" wx:if="{{item.type==1}}">{{item.content}}</view>
|
|
|
- <image src="{{item.content}}" wx:else class="msgImg" mode="widthFix" bindtap="previewImage"
|
|
|
- data-src="{{item.content}}" />
|
|
|
+ <view class="contentBox">
|
|
|
+ <view class="time">
|
|
|
+ {{filters.formatDate(item.gmtCreated,1)}}
|
|
|
+ </view>
|
|
|
+ <view class="message" wx:if="{{item.type==1}}">{{item.content}}</view>
|
|
|
+ <image src="{{item.content}}" wx:else class="msgImg" mode="widthFix" bindtap="previewImage"
|
|
|
+ data-src="{{item.content}}" />
|
|
|
+ </view>
|
|
|
<image src="{{userInfo.avatar}}" class="avatar" bindtap="jumpUserInfo" data-uid='{{item.senderUid}}' />
|
|
|
</view>
|
|
|
</block>
|